Pursuit in Ontario County leads to variety of charges against Victor driver

Deputies report the arrest of a 20-year-old Victor man following a pursuit in Ontario County.

The Ontario County Sheriff’s Office reports that deputies attempted to stop Gage Dalton, 20, of Victor on Brace Road for unauthorized use of emergency lights.

At that point, Dalton led deputies on a pursuit before crashing at the intersection of McCann Road and County Road 30.

He was arrested for unlawful fleeing in a motor vehicle, as well as criminal possession of a weapon.

An additional charge of criminal mischief is also pending due to ‘extensive damage’ caused by the crash.

Deputies say a number of vehicle and traffic tickets were also issued. All of the charges will be answered in Victor Town Court.
